UPDATE: Victim identified in fatal Route 20 collision

Members of the Delaware State Police say they are investigating what caused a fatal crash along Route 20 Thursday afternoon.

According to their report, the driver of a Ford Escape apparently crossed into the path of a Mack truck. Police say the driver of the truck braked, but could not avoid a collision with the oncoming Escape.

Troopers say the driver of the Escape, Lisa Wyatt, 50, of Selbyville, died at the scene. The driver of the Mack truck was treated for minor injuries.

Route 20 between Godwin School Road and Country Living Road was closed for four and half hours as clean-up crews and investigators cleared the scene. DNREC also responded to assist with a minor diesel fuel spill from the truck tanks.
